    Excuse my ignorance but what exactly is "the knowledge"?

    The exam that London black cab/Hackney Carriage wannabees have to pass on London streets and landmarks to obtain their licence has come to be known as 'The Knowledge'. It is difficult !!

    Are you doing it wizann or kp, I'm just finishing book 2 wizann way 160 runs, I was told by a few people to get runs done first, start points then join school / call over partner/s
    Joining school before finishing runs is a waste of money IMO
    But keep at it remember no one fails the knowledge
    They only give up!
